AT A GLANCE
- Concept: Physical Qubits: The raw, highly unstable hardware components that process quantum information.
- Concept: Logical Qubits: A stable, software-defined entity created by bundling thousands of physical qubits together.
- Concept: Syndrome Measurement: Ancilla qubits constantly check neighboring data qubits for errors without destroying their state.
- Concept: Decoding Loops: Classical algorithms calculate and apply error corrections in fractions of a microsecond.
HOW IT WORKS
Quantum computers process information using subatomic properties. These states are incredibly fragile. A slight change in temperature, stray microwave radiation, or even cosmic rays will cause a qubit to flip its state or lose its phase entirely.
Traditional computers fix errors by keeping backup copies of data. Quantum physics strictly forbids copying an unknown quantum state. Engineers cannot simply back up a qubit to check if an error occurred.
The surface code solves this by spreading a single piece of quantum information across a massive two-dimensional grid of physical qubits. Engineers divide this grid into two categories: data qubits that hold the actual information, and measure qubits that act as supervisors.

The system executes continuous syndrome measurement cycles. The measure qubits, often called ancillas, briefly interact with their neighboring data qubits to detect parity changes. They extract this error data without ever observing the actual hidden quantum information, preserving the fragile state.
This measurement generates a continuous flood of error data called a syndrome. A classical supercomputer sits adjacent to the quantum processor, running high-speed decoding algorithms to interpret this syndrome map.
The classical algorithm calculates exactly which physical qubit failed. It then applies a software correction to the system before the next computational step begins, isolating the error before it can corrupt the entire grid.
Surface Code Breakeven Simulator
Observe how the physical error rate dictates whether scaling physical hardware produces stable logical qubits or mathematically collapses the system.
WHY IT MATTERS NOW
Financial markets and national security agencies track quantum computing due to its theoretical ability to break standard RSA encryption. Running Shor's algorithm to crack modern cryptography requires millions of consecutive, error-free operations. Current raw quantum hardware fails after just a few dozen steps.
The industry currently operates in the Noisy Intermediate-Scale Quantum era. Machines feature hundreds of physical qubits, but they remain too unstable for complex commercial applications. Useful quantum computing requires fault tolerance.
The surface code dictates the actual economics of this fault tolerance. Because current hardware is so noisy, bundling a single stable logical qubit requires up to ten thousand physical qubits. A machine with one thousand physical qubits effectively yields zero computational value if it cannot form a single logical unit.
This mathematical reality shifts the bottleneck from quantum physics to classical engineering. IBM and Google Quantum AI currently spend massive capital not just on supercooling chips, but on building specialized classical microprocessors capable of running syndrome decoding loops in under a microsecond.
WHAT MOST PEOPLE MISS
Mainstream technology reporting fixates entirely on raw physical qubit counts. Headlines celebrate when a company announces a new thousand-qubit processor. They ignore the underlying hardware error rates entirely.
Adding more physical qubits actually makes the machine worse if the error rate remains too high. The hidden operational threshold is the surface code breakeven point. Until the physical hardware noise drops below a specific mathematical limit, adding more physical qubits simply generates errors faster than the classical decoding algorithm can track them.
THE TRAJECTORY
Next 12–36 Months: Hardware developers will demonstrate persistent logical qubits that mathematically outlive their underlying physical components. They will chain together two or three logical qubits to execute basic error-corrected algorithms, proving the physical viability of topological codes.
Next Five Years: Foundries will physically integrate the classical decoding logic directly into the cryogenic control electronics. This reduces the latency of sending error syndromes back to room-temperature servers, allowing the system to scale beyond a few dozen logical qubits without massive signal delay.
Next Ten Years: The ratio of physical to logical qubits will compress dramatically. Advanced error-correcting architectures, such as low-density parity-check codes, will replace the standard two-dimensional surface code. This allows engineers to build a single logical qubit using hundreds, rather than thousands, of physical components.
What Could Go Wrong: Cosmic radiation causes correlated errors, striking multiple physical qubits simultaneously. The surface code assumes errors happen independently. If a single radiation strike knocks out an entire localized grid, the syndrome decoder will fail to reconstruct the logical state, crashing the calculation entirely.
Most Likely Outcome: Quantum computing will evolve into a heavily hybrid architecture. Classical supercomputers will handle the massive computational load of continuous error decoding, serving as the inescapable physical infrastructure that keeps the fragile quantum processor mathematically stable.
KEY TERMS
- Surface Code: A topological error correction method that arranges physical qubits in a two-dimensional grid to collectively protect a single logical state.
- Logical Qubit: A stable unit of quantum information created by networking multiple physical qubits together with continuous error correction software.
- Syndrome Measurement: The process of extracting error information from a quantum system without destroying the underlying quantum data.
- Ancilla Qubit: A specialized physical qubit used strictly for measuring errors and interacting with data qubits, rather than storing information.
- Fault Tolerance: The architectural ability of a quantum computer to continue operating accurately even when individual physical components fail.
SOURCES
- Google Quantum AI — Suppressing quantum errors by scaling a surface code logical qubit
- National Institute of Standards and Technology (NIST) — Quantum Error Correction and Fault Tolerance
- IBM Quantum — Quantum Error Mitigation and Error Correction
- Physical Review X — Surface codes: Towards practical large-scale quantum computation